Location & Connectivity — Wadala / Azad Nagar Corridor
Wadala is Mumbai's most operationally rebuilt eastern submarket of the last decade — the Eastern Freeway opened the entire eastern bayfront to private vehicle traffic at speed, the Atal Setu (Mumbai Trans-Harbour Link) put Navi Mumbai inside a 30-minute drive at any hour, and the BKC-Sion Connector formalised the BKC commute. Godrej Horizon Tower 2's specific position on Rafi Ahmed Kidwai Road in Azad Nagar puts it inside walking distance of Five Gardens (2 minutes) — the most lifestyle-stable green corridor inside the eastern central Mumbai axis — and a 4-minute drive from Dadar TT Circle. The Eastern Freeway ramp is 6 minutes; once on the freeway, P.D'Mello Road and Wadi Bunder are 12 minutes, Fort and Mantralaya are 18 minutes, and the southern tip at Nariman Point is 22 minutes.
The BKC drive is the most quoted metric — 18 minutes via the BKC-Sion Connector at off-peak and 22–25 minutes at the 9:30 a.m. peak. That outcome competes directly with Worli (16–20 minutes to BKC) and Mahalaxmi (20–24 minutes to BKC) at structurally lower PSF. Metro Line 4 (Wadala–Kasarvadavali) construction is active with Wadala Truck Terminal station inside an 8-minute walk; Metro Lines 10 (Gaimukh–Shivaji Chowk) and 11 (Wadala–CSMT) extend the metro footprint from Wadala into central and southern Mumbai by end-2028. Mono-rail Wadala station is currently 3 minutes away. Wadala Railway Station (Harbour Line) is 6 minutes; Dadar Railway Station (Western + Central) is 10 minutes by road. Education within 10 minutes: IB World School, Don Bosco High School, SIES College, KJ Somaiya. Healthcare within 10 minutes: SL Raheja Hospital, Hinduja Hospital Khar branch (15 min). Retail: High Street Phoenix (Lower Parel) 16 min, Korum Mall Thane 35 min, Inorbit Vashi 28 min via Atal Setu.

Skip Godrej Horizon Tower 2 if you need: a ready-to-move possession (this is December 2027); a sea-view product (the Eastern Bay frame is a sunrise-and-skyline view, not a Worli/Bandra West sea-face); or a sub-₹3 Cr ticket (the entry sits at ₹3.18 Cr and the volume slots open at ₹5 Cr+). Negotiate on: GST and stamp-duty inclusion at the displayed price (the active ask in some PB slots is GST-and-stamp-duty inclusive while others are exclusive — confirm at LOI); maintenance corpus deposit (Godrej standard is 24 months upfront; buyer can negotiate to 12 months with a top-up at OC); car-park count on the 3 BHK ladder (2,212 sqft format should land 2 reserved + 1 stack lift); and the floor-rise premium (Godrej publishes a transparent floor-rise table — verify your unit's notional floor band against the price card before deposit). — Property Butler

What is the maintenance charge at Godrej Horizon Tower 2?
Godrej Properties' indicative maintenance ladder for the Horizon project is ₹6–7/sqft per month at handover, with a 24-month corpus deposit standard at registration. On a 1,477 sqft 3 BHK that is roughly ₹8,800–10,300 per month at the launch slab, with a corpus deposit in the ₹2.1–2.5 lakh range. Are home loans approved for Godrej Horizon Tower 2?
Yes. HDFC, ICICI, SBI, and Axis Bank have project-level approvals in place on Godrej Horizon, which means a buyer's individual loan sanction process is a credit-only file (no project-clearance overhead).
